C1945 Engine Trouble Code
What is C1945?
C1945 code can indicate a faulty oxygen sensor, which may eventually damage the catalytic converter (repair cost: $2,000–$2,200). Professional diagnosis costs around $200–$210. Oxygen sensors are often straightforward to replace — check your owner's manual for location and instructions. This issue should be addressed promptly to prevent further damage.
Code Information
| Code Type: | OBD-II Chassis (C) Trouble Code |
| System: | Chassis |
| Code: | C1945 |
C1945 Symptoms
Check Engine Light
Illuminated dashboard warning
Engine Stalling
Engine stops unexpectedly or misfires
Performance Issues
Reduced power or acceleration
Starting Problems
Difficulty starting the engine
C1945 Code Structure
Understanding what each digit means in the C1945 chassis trouble code:
| C | 1 | 9 | 4 | 5 |
|---|---|---|---|---|
| Chassis Code | Fuel And Air Metering | Injector Circuit Malfunction - Cylinders | Injection Pump Fuel Metering Control 'B' High | Crankshaft Position Sensor B Circuit Malfunction |
How to Fix C1945
Diagnostic Steps:
Regarding C1945, carefully inspect the wire harness near the intake manifold bracket, best accessed from below near the oil filter. Look for chafing, pinching, or damaged insulation.
Repair Solution:
Brake switch circuit concerns may involve open or shorted BPP circuits, damaged switches, or misadjustment. Verify stoplight function and follow proper self-test procedures per service manual.
Technical Notes:
C1945 DTC indicating a sensor fault does not always mean the sensor itself is bad. The issue may stem from the systems being monitored or even the sensor wiring. Proper diagnosis is essential.
C1945 Description
C1945 engine trouble code is related to Crankshaft Position Sensor B Circuit Malfunction.
Main Cause
The primary reason for C1945 OBD-II Engine Trouble Code is: Injector Circuit Malfunction - Cylinders.